Case Details
This patient in her 40s presented with heavy lateral hooding on both sides that made her looked aged.
During evaluation, Dr. Phan noted lateral hooding on both sides. Left side appeared saggier than the right. The left side seemed worse because of the left brow rather than because of more skin. The drooping left brow pushed down into the skin fold, causing it to sag lower. Dr. Phan, therefore, recommended bilateral upper blepharoplasty and left brow lift. While patient was prepared for the former and not the latter, Dr. Phan proceeded with bilateral upper blepharoplasty and left PDO thread brow lift.
PDO threads were placed under the forehead skin to engage and lift the skin and thus brow. This lift lasted about one year. PDO threads may be replaced as many times as desired.
Patient, pictured here 4-months post bilateral blepharoplasty and left PDO thread brow lift, demonstrated refreshed and more symmetrical looking eyes.
